PRE-REQUISITES OF OPTIMUM
         FURNACE EFFICIENCY.

• Design of refractory lining and furnace to
  ensure proper heat distribution in furnace.
• Pre-heating furnace oil up to 100°C.
• Use of recuperator and recovery of heat
  from flue gases.
• Frequent burner cleaning and tuning.
• Control of heat loss from furnace openings.
PRE-REQUISITES OF OPTIMUM
         FURNACE EFFICIENCY.
• Complete Combustion with Minimum
  Excess Air.

• 45% Alumina Refractory Bricks. TESTED.
     -Fe2O3 test : not more than 2%.

• Fortified Refractory Lining by use of
  Refractory Coating.
REFRACTORY PROBLEMS
1. Thermal Shock Cracking.
2. Carbon deposits on the Burner Blocks.
3. Low Emissivity.
4. Corrosive Action.
5. Vicious Sand Blasting Effect.
6. Linear Expansion of Bricks Lead to
    Increased Furnace Skin Temperature.

PROPERTIES OF ESPON-RCP
General:
Non Toxic, Odourless, Tasteless.

Chemical Resistance:
 After firing, ESPON-RCP is unaffected by
 most acids and alkalies in liquid or gaseous
 form. Resistance to SO2 & V2O5.

                                          Contd.. 2,
PROPERTIES OF ESPON-RCP
Physical Properties:
Slightly plastic above 200 deg. C.
Thermal expansion: 1% over the range of
                   0 to 1900 deg. C.
Shrinkage : 0.25% max.
Bulk Density: 2.42 gms/cc
Coverage: 1.5 kgs/sq.m
